    A nurse is applying soft limb restraints to a child who is acting aggressively toward staff. Which of the following actions should the nurse take?

    Explanation & Rationale

    The correct answer is Choice C.Choice A rationaleRestraint prescriptions should be renewed every 24 hours, not 48 hours, to ensure the child’s safety and necessity of restraints.Choice B rationaleRestraints should never be tied to the side rails as this can cause injury. They should be tied to the bed frame.Choice C rationaleQuick-release knots are recommended for restraints to ensure they can be removed quickly in an emergency.Choice D rationaleThe child should be assessed more frequently than every 4 hours, typically every 2 hours, to ensure their safety and comfort.
